The Technology

Built on Sodium-Ion NCO Chemistry

Genezen Energy's platform uses sodium-ion NaCrO2 / NCO chemistry designed for safer, longer-lasting, and more resilient energy storage. The chemistry uses abundant sodium-based materials and avoids lithium, cobalt, nickel, and copper.

Engineered around intrinsic safety and safe venting during failure.

Narrow voltage range supports stable power output and efficiency.

High tap density helps increase volumetric energy and reduce footprint.

Designed for drop-in use across industry-standard form factors.

Residential Storage

TitanCore 48V Sodium-Ion Residential Storage

TitanCore is a 9.25 kWh 48V sodium-ion residential energy storage system designed for safer home backup, solar self-consumption, and resilient power through hot and cold climates.

9.25 kWhRated energy
46.4VNominal voltage
10,000Cell cycles at 25°C

Ultra Safe

NaCrO2 / NCO innovation is described as eliminating thermal-runaway risk.

All-Weather Performance

Discharge from -40°C to 60°C and charge from -20°C to 60°C.

No Maintenance

Fully passive operation with no cooling required and compatibility with existing inverters.

Utility and Turnkey BESS

Scalable Sodium-Ion BESS Architecture

Atlas scales from a sodium-ion NCO module to rack and full containerized BESS architecture for commercial, industrial, and utility deployment.

Module

31 kWh

1P 52S sodium-ion NCO module with 210 Ah capacity and 15.5 kW power at 0.5P.

Rack

253 kWh

1P 8S module rack with 1206 V nominal voltage and 126.5 kW power at 0.5P.

Full BESS

3039 kWh

12P rack containerized BESS with 1500 kW power at 0.5P and -40°C to 60°C operation.
